This guide to moths, native plants, and their environmental roles is an indispensable resource for gardeners, conservationists, and nature enthusiasts across the midwestern United States.

Gardening for Moths in the Midwest is the first book to show midwestern gardeners and naturalists why they should attract specific moth species to their properties and how to do it. The book’s stunning color photographs and intriguing facts reveal the fascinating world of these insects, inspiring readers to incorporate moth-loving native plants into their landscapes. The authors emphasize the importance of moths and their caterpillars to ecological food webs, widening the book’s appeal to birders and bat lovers as well.

The book consists of three main sections, beginning with a thorough overview of moths, including their

  • population decline and conservation
  • importance in ecosystems
  • relationship with native plants
  • predators and defenses
In addition, this first section features tips on how to attract and photograph moths at night.

In the next section the authors profile about 140 plant species, providing brief background, natural history, habitat, and growing notes for each along with lists of potential moths the plants may attract.

The third section highlights approximately 150 moth species, ordered taxonomically. These accounts include interesting facts about the life history of both the caterpillar and adult moth of each species. Each account also features a list of the species’ common host plants.

Throughout the volume, inset text boxes provide additional fascinating moth facts. Beautiful photographs (most by the authors) illustrate every included plant and moth species. Select references, online resources, and quick reference tables round out this valuable resource.

Описание: The first publication of Jones's Icones, a strikingly beautiful and significant achievement in natural history.

William Jones's Icones is one of the most scientifically important and visually stunning works on butterflies and moths ever created. Icones contains finely delineated paintings of more than 760 species of Lepidoptera, many of which it described for the first time, marking a critical moment in the study of natural history. Yet until now, it has never been published--the only existing manuscript copy is housed in the archives of the Oxford University Museum of Natural History. With Iconotypes, Jones's work is published for the first time, accompanied by expert commentary and contextual essays, and featuring annotated maps showing where each specimen was discovered.

Between the early 1780s and 1810, Jones, a wine merchant, painted in painstaking detail hundreds of species of Lepidoptera, drawing from his own collection and the collections of prominent amateur naturalists. For every specimen, Jones included the known species name, the collection, and the geographical location in which it was found. In this enhanced facsimile, entomologist Dick Vane-Wright provides context for the historical references in the original, updates the taxonomic and common names, and includes information about species that have since gone extinct. Vane-Wright also provides an account of Jones's life and his motivation for collecting butterflies, evaluating the significance of Jones's work. This lavish volume intersperses contemporary maps showing the locations of each specimen, expert essays on the study of lepidoptery since Ancient Egyptian times, the development of taxonomy after Linnaeus, the roles of collectors and natural history artists during the late 1700s to mid-1800s, and the steep decline of butterflies and moths over the last fifty years. Iconotypes is a beautiful collector's object for fans of natural history and illustrations of butterflies and moths, as well as artists, designers, and bibliophiles.

A stunning portrait of the nocturnal moths of Central and South America by famed American photographer Emmet Gowin

American photographer Emmet Gowin (b. 1941) is best known for his portraits of his wife, Edith, and their family, as well as for his images documenting the impact of human activity upon landscapes around the world. For the past fifteen years, he has been engaged in an equally profound project on a different scale, capturing the exquisite beauty of more than one thousand species of nocturnal moths in Bolivia, Brazil, Ecuador, French Guiana, and Panama.

These stunning color portraits present the insects--many of which may never have been photographed as living specimens before, and some of which may not be seen again--arrayed in typologies of twenty-five per sheet. The moths are photographed alive, in natural positions and postures, and set against a variety of backgrounds taken from the natural world and images from art history.

Throughout Gowin's distinguished career, his work has addressed urgent concerns. The arresting images of Mariposas Nocturnas extend this reach, as Gowin fosters awareness for a part of nature that is generally left unobserved and calls for a greater awareness of the biodiversity and value of the tropics as a universally shared natural treasure. An essay by Gowin provides a fascinating personal history of his work with biologists and introduces both the photographic and philosophical processes behind this extraordinary project.

Essential reading for audiences both in photography and natural history, this lavishly illustrated volume reminds readers that, as Terry Tempest Williams writes in her foreword, "The world is saturated with loveliness, inhabited by others far more adept at living with uncertainty than we are."
